The Silo Hotel

The Silo Hotel rises above Cape Town's V&A Waterfront in the upper floors of the former grain silo complex. It is one of the city's most recognizable hotel buildings. Pillowed glass windows, strong industrial bones, and wide views shape the stay from the first arrival moment. From the rooms and rooftop, guests can see Table Mountain, Signal Hill, the harbor, the Atlantic Ocean, and the city. Below the hotel sits Zeitz MOCAA, the Museum of Contemporary Art Africa, which gives the stay a direct link to Cape Town's art scene.

The hotel feels more like an art-filled private house in the sky than a large resort. It has only 28 rooms and suites, so the atmosphere is intimate, highly designed, and personal. The location in the Silo District keeps guests close to the Waterfront's restaurants, shops, marina, Robben Island ferry, Two Oceans Aquarium, and city attractions. At the same time, the views and height create a sense of distance from the busy promenade below.

Rooms & Suites

Rooms and suites at The Silo Hotel are bold, colorful, and full of character. Each room uses the building's unusual geometry, with tall convex windows that frame Cape Town from different angles. Views can include Table Mountain, Lion's Head, Signal Hill, the harbor, city rooftops, or the Waterfront. Bathrooms are often a highlight, with freestanding tubs placed to make the most of the outlook.

The 28 accommodations range from Silo Rooms and Duplex Suites to larger Royal Suites and the One Bedroom Penthouse. The style is not minimal. Expect rich fabrics, bright colors, layered patterns, antiques, contemporary African art, and playful details. The result feels personal and curated. It suits guests who want a hotel with a strong point of view rather than a neutral international look.

Because the hotel is small, service feels close and responsive. It works well for couples, art travelers, design-minded guests, and visitors who want a Cape Town stay with a sense of place. Larger suites also suit guests who want more room for a special occasion, a longer visit, or a stay that includes private dining and hosted moments.

Dining & Bars

The Granary Cafe is the main restaurant and serves breakfast, lunch, afternoon tea, and dinner in a room with city and harbor views. The menu is locally inspired, polished, and flexible enough for guests who want anything from a quiet breakfast to a full evening meal. The room's height and windows give even a simple meal a strong Cape Town setting.

The Willaston Bar is more intimate and works well for cocktails, wine, light meals, and evenings that do not need a formal restaurant plan. It has a club-like mood, with art, texture, and views forming part of the experience. The Wisdom Room is available for private dining and small gatherings. It suits celebrations, hosted dinners, or business meals that need privacy.

The Silo Rooftop is one of the hotel's signature spaces. Open daily when weather allows, it serves light meals, snacks, wine, and cocktails with panoramic views over the V&A Waterfront and wider Cape Town. The rooftop also includes the guest pool area, giving hotel guests a rare high-level outdoor space above the city.

Rooftop, Spa & Art

The rooftop is a defining part of the stay. From here, guests can look across the Waterfront, Table Mountain, Signal Hill, the harbor, and the Atlantic. The heated infinity pool is reserved for hotel guests, while the rooftop bar creates a social setting for drinks and light meals. It is especially strong at sunset, when the city, mountain, and harbor change color around the building.

The Silo Spa adds a quieter counterpoint to the art and rooftop energy. It offers treatment rooms, wellness therapies, and a calm space for recovery after city touring, hiking, wine-country days, or long flights. A small gym supports basic fitness routines. The hotel is not a large spa resort, but the wellness offering fits the boutique scale and high-design setting.

Art is central to the hotel's identity. Guests stay above Zeitz MOCAA and are surrounded by contemporary African works throughout the property. The building itself is part of the experience, transformed from a 1920s grain silo into a modern Cape Town icon. This makes The Silo Hotel especially appealing for guests who care about architecture, culture, photography, and local creative energy.

V&A Waterfront Location

The V&A Waterfront is one of Cape Town's easiest bases for first-time visitors. It offers restaurants, shopping, the marina, the Robben Island ferry, Two Oceans Aquarium, food markets, and simple access to car transfers. From The Silo Hotel, guests can explore the Waterfront on foot. They can then use a driver or guide for Table Mountain, Lion's Head, the city bowl, Camps Bay, Clifton, Kirstenbosch, Constantia, or the Winelands.

The location is practical, but it is also visually rich. The hotel looks toward many of the landmarks that define Cape Town, so the city feels present even when guests stay inside. For travelers who want to combine museum time, restaurants, shopping, sightseeing, and scenic drives, the Silo District works very well.

Who It Suits

The Silo Hotel is best for guests who want a small, art-led luxury hotel with major views and a strong Cape Town identity. Couples appreciate the rooftop, design, and dramatic rooms. Culture-focused travelers gain direct access to Zeitz MOCAA and the Waterfront's galleries, shops, and restaurants. First-time visitors like the walkable base and easy touring logistics.

Compared with One&Only Cape Town, The Silo Hotel is smaller, more vertical, and more design-focused. Cape Grace has a classic marina mood, while Mount Nelson offers garden heritage away from the Waterfront. Ellerman House is more residential and ocean-facing in Bantry Bay. The Silo Hotel stands apart for architecture, art, rooftop views, and the feeling of sleeping inside one of Cape Town's defining modern landmarks. It is a vivid choice for travelers who want the hotel itself to be part of the Cape Town story.
